
Prominent Opposition Figure Arrested in Venezuela on Terrorism Charges
Venezuelan authorities announced the arrest of Juan Pablo Guanipa, a prominent opposition figure, on charges of plotting terrorist attacks to disrupt the upcoming May 25th elections. The arrest is part of a broader crackdown on an alleged international terrorist network. Authorities showcased notebooks, agendas, and weapons seized during the operation. "We have dismantled a significant threat to our democracy," a government official stated. The arrest has been met with mixed reactions, with opposition groups questioning the legitimacy of the charges. The incident underscores the heightened political tensions in Venezuela leading up to the elections. The government's swift action demonstrates its resolve to ensure a secure electoral process.
